RAS MAIN-ANIMAL HUSBANDRY
ANIMAL HUSBANDRY AND VETERINARY SCIENCE
PAPER-I (Code No. 03)
Unit Subject matter
1. Animal Breeding & Genetics :
Frequency of genes and genotype; Hardy-weinbug law and equilibrium frequencies, Forces changing gene frequencies- mutation, migration and selection. Variation, their causes, Partitioning of phenotypic variance, Estimation of additive, non-additive and environmental variance in animal populations, Genetic nature of differences between species and breeds of livestock. Resemblance between relatives. Heritability, repeatability, genetic and environmental correlations.
Concept and measurement of relationship. Mating systems; Inbreeding and out breeding; their uses, consequences and limitations. Bases and methods of selection; their effective and limitations. Selection indices, sire indices,. Interspecific hybridization. Estimation and utilization of general and specific combining ability. Diallel crossing. Recurrent selection and reciprocal recurrent selection. Breeding efficiency and factors affecting.
2. Animal Nutrition:
Digestive system of ruminants and non ruminants. Major and minor nutrients, their functions, symptoms of deficiency and sources. Digestion, absorption and metabolism of carbohydrates., fats and proteins. Digestibility coefficients and feed evaluation. Basal feeds, energy and protein supplements, agro-industrial by products and non conventional feeds. Top feeds. Feed additives. Methods of improving low quality roughages. Conservation of green fodders. Antinutritive factors in feeds and fodders. Feeding standards for farm animals. Computation of balance ration and feeding of various categories of livestock. Feeding of livestock during drought and scarcity periods. Supply of green fodder throughout the year. Pasture and its management. Grazing methods.
3. Livestock Production and Management:
a. Breeds: Origin, distribution, characteristics and utility of important breeds of cattle, buffalo, sheep, goat, pig, camel and poultry.
b. Management :
(i) Cattle & buffalo: Oestrus, its detection and insemination. Care of pregnant and parturient cow. Care of calf, growing and milking animals, bull and bullocks. Grooming, exercise, bathing, milking, castration, marking, dehorning and age determination. Systems of housing under various agro-climatic conditions.
(ii) Sheep and goat : Management of breeding goats and sheep, browsing, grazing, feeding and housing.
(iii) Camel : Breeding, feeding, housing and management of camel. Meat and wool production and marketing.
(iv) Pigs: Feeding, breeding, housing and management of pigs.
(v) Poultry : Present status and future scope of poultry farming. Egg structure, formation, selection, incubation and hatching. Rearing of chicks and management of growers and layers,. Broiler production,. Housing chicken. Poultry housing equipments. marketing of eggs, poultry and its meat.
c. Dairy Science : Present status and future scope of diary industry in India. Milk Production and its utilization. Principles involved in production of safe & clean milk. Physico-chemical and nutritional properties of milk. Quality measurements of milk and milk products. Legal standards. Pasteurization, sterilization and homogenization of milk. Phosphates test, adulteration of milk and its detection. Manufacture of milk products and their marketing. Cleaning and sterilization of dairy equipments.
d. Extension : Extension programmes in Animal Husbandry. Dairy development projects organizing milk producers and dairy cooperatives.
ANIMAL HUSBANDRY AND VETERINARY SCIENCE
PAPER-II (Code No.03)
Unit Subject matter
1. Pharmacology :
Principles of drug action. Pharmacology of drugs acting on digestive, respiratory, nervous, excretory and circulatory systems. Chemotherapeutic drugs, anthelminthics, insecticides.
2. Microbiology :
Morphology and cell structure of bacteria : Classification and nomenclature of bacteria. Bacteriostatic and bactericidal substances. Antigens, immunoglobulin classes and sub classes. Antigen-antibody reactions. Types of immunity and their classification. Different methods of confirming and their interactions. Bacteriophage, study of viruses responsible for common disease on the basis of etiology, virus characters, pathogenicity, transmission.
3. Parasitology:
Introduction to parasitology, types of parasitism, host parasite relationship, resistance to parasites, importance of parasites in animal health, Broad classification of parasite, Pathogenicity, symptoms, treatment, control and immunity of common parasitic diseases caused by trematodes, cestodes, nematodes and protozoan parasites Role and importance of arthropods in relation, transmission of disease.
4. Pathology :
General pathology-disturbance of cell metabolism-degenerations and infiltrations. Disturbances of circulation and cell growth. Inflammation of urogenital, digestive, nervous and integumentary systems.
5. Medicine and Public Health:
General remarks on etiology, symptoms, diagnosis and treatments of diseases of digestive, respiratory, cardiovascular, nervous systems and skin. Common causes of poisoning in animals. their signs and treatment.
Post-mortem examination of vetero-legal cases, vetero-legal wounds, common frauds in the sale of livestock and livestock products, cruelty against animals in India.
Study of incidence, etiology, mode of infection, symptoms, course, diagnosis, prognosis, treatment, prevention and control of common bacterial, viral rickettsial and parasitic diseases of domesticated animals and poultry in India.
General principles, nature and problems of meat inspection. Examination of animals before slaughter, methods of slaughter, dressing of carcasses, postmortem inspection, spoilage of meat and meat products.
6. Surgery & Radiology:
General surgery including wounds, thermal injuries, fractures their classification, signs and treatments. Shock sutures and ligatures. Sterilization. Reasons for administration of preanaesthetics and anesthetic. Local and general anesthesia. Anesthetic accidents and emergencies. Regional surgery of head, neck, chest and abdomen of common surgical affections. Surgical affections of fore limbs and hind limbs. Importance of veterinary radiology as diagnostic and therapeutic aid.
7. Obstetrics & Gynecology:
Animal reproduction- anatomy and functions of male and female reproductive organs, sperm physiology and morphology, semen and its composition, Artificial insemination. Semen diluters, Free zing. Merits, demerits, methods and storage. Infertility : study of diseases of genital organs their etiology, symptoms and treatment. Physiology of parturition, handling of dystopia, pre and post-partum complications. Study of mammary gland.

RAS MAIN-AGRICULTURE ENGINEERING
AGRICULTURE ENGINEERING PAPER-I (Code No.02)
Soil and Water Conservation :- Forms of precipitation, Hydrologic
cycle, Point rainfall analysis, frequency analysis. Water shed-definition
and concept, agricultural Watersheds, prediction of peak runoff, factors
affecting runoff, Hydrograph, Concepts of unit and instantaneous
hydrographs. Erosion-type, affecting factors, damages associated with
erosion, assessment of actual annual soil loss by erosion and its impact on
agricultural production and productivity. Erosion control measures on
various classes of lands i.e. contour cultivation, Strip cropping, terracing,
afforestation, pastures etc. A critical analysis of the role of vegetation in
soil and water conservation, grassed water way and its design. Design of
gully control measures including permanent structures i.e. chute spillway,
Drop spillway, drop inlet spillway, retards and Stream Bank erosion,
flood routing, flood amelioration through soil and water management in
upstream zone, mechanics of wind and water erosion, wind erosion
control, water harvesting structures i.e. Khadin, Tanka, Nada and Anicut.
Irrigation-Soil-Water-Plant relationship, permeability, Infiltration,
Percolation, water requirements of crops and irrigation scheduling, direct
and indirect methods of soil moisture measurements, Measurements of
irrigation water-Orifice, Weirs, Notches, Parshall flumes, H-flumes etc.
Water conveyance and control, design of field channels and Canals,
Lacey and Kennedy theories, Most economical channel cross section.
Selection of underground pipe line structures and their design, irrigation
methods, their hydraulics and design viz-Border, Furrow, Flood, Drip and
sprinklers methods, concepts in irrigation efficiencies.
Drainage :- Benefits of drainage, Hydraulic conductivity, Drainable
porosity, Drainage Coefficient. Surface drainage, Drainage o flat and
slopping lands. Design of open ditches, their alignment and construction.
Design and layout of sub surface drains, depth and spacing of drains and
drainage outlets, installation of drains and drainage wells, drainage wells,
drainage of salt affected areas.
Pumps :- Design, Construction, Performance characteristics,
selection, installation, working principle and maintenance of
Reciprocating Pump, Centrifugal Pump, Turbine Pump, Submersible
Pump, Propellers, Jet and air left pumps and hydraulic ram.
Water Resources Development and Management :- Water
resources of India, Surface water, Ground water, development of
irrigation potential, Canal irrigation, Command area development, on
farm development works, acquifier parameters, Hydraulics of wells,
steady and unsteady flow, well log, construction of wells, Design of well
screen, well development.
Fluid Mechanics :- Fluid properties, units and dimensions, mass,
momentum and energy conservation principles, Navier stoke equation,
Vorticity-flow of fluids in pipes and channels, Friction factor, turbulence,
instruments, and measurement systems.
Surveying, Leveling and Land Development :- Linear
measurements, different surveying devices and methods, land grading and
leveling, contouring and terracing, each work estimation, Land
Development Budgeting, earth moving machinery and theodelite.
AGRICULTURE ENGINEERING PAPER-II (Code No.02)
Agricultural Processing :- Various size reduction machinery and
energy requirement. Material Handing Equipment, Separation equipmentbased
on size shape and surface characteristics, Heating and Cooling of
food products, mode of heat transfer, different types of heat exchanges,
Psychrometry chart and its application in drying EMC and its
determination, Principles of drying and drying equipments, types of
evaporators, single and multiple effect evaporators, Refrigeration load
calculation, various milling process-Rice, maize, wheat, and pulse
milling, Parboiling of wheat and paddy. Storage of grains and their
design. Principles of food preservation and thermal processing.
Farm Electrification and machine :- AC-DC Machines, DOL
starter, Transformer, 3-phase Induction Motors and Alternators,
Transmission and distribution of electricity. Selection, Installation and
general cares of electric motors on farms, selection of wire sizes based on
Indian standards. Types of wiring and design of wiring systems, Rural
electrification.
Farm Power :- Classification of Internal combustion (IC) engines
terminology, Otto diesel cycle, engine components, Fuel supply system,
Lubrication system. Cooling system and Governing system.
Types of Tractors, Brakes, Power Transmission system,
Differential, Mechanics of tractor chassis, Steering system, Hydraulic
system and selection of tractors.
Rural Housing :- Building materials and their properties, Design of
Beams, Slabs, Columns and foundations, Planning and design of Rural
houses, Farm Roads, Village drainage system, waste disposal and sanitary
structures, material and cost estimation in construction. Integrated Rural
energy planning and development.
Farm Machinery :- Types of hitching systems and hydraulic depth
and draft control Selection of sowing and planting equipment and their
calibration, Precision planting. Selection and calibration of Sprayers and
Dusters. Selection and operation principles of Harvesting and threshing
machines. Cost analysis of farm equipment and related numerical
problems.
Renewable Energy :- Solar Radiation-its measurement, solar
thermal devices and gadgets i.e. solar cooper, solar water heater, solar
dryer, solar refrigeration and Air conditions etc. Solar Photovoltaic
devices i.e. solar lantern, street light, power pack. Bio energy-production,
conversion and utilization route, Biogas-type classification and design of
Biogas Plant. Biomass gasification, Alcoholic fermentation (Ethanol and
Methanol Production) wind energy conversion process i.e., water
pumping, wind mills, and Aero generator. Fuel cell and other chemical
sources of energy.

SYLLABUS OF RAS MAIN-Compulsury Papers
SYLLABI OF THE PAPER/SUBJECTS PRESCRIBED FOR
THE MAIN EXAMINATION
COMPULSORY PAPERS/SUBJECTS
PAPER-I. GENERAL KNOWLEDGE AND GENERAL SCIENCE
1. Current Affairs - Current events of State, National and
International importance, International agencies, their activities,
Economic and Political aspects in India and organisations and
institutions working in these fields. Games and sports at State,
National and International Levels.
2. General Science - Questions on General Science will cover general
appreciation and understanding of Science including matters of
everyday observations and experience as may be expected of and
enlightened person though he may not have made any special study
of science. Question to test the candidate's acquaintance with
matters such as Electronics, Tele-communication. Satellies and the
like should also be included.
3. Geography and Natural resources -
(a) Broad physical features o the world, important places, rivese,
mountains, continents, oceans.
(b) Natural resources of India, Mines and minerals, Forests, land
and water, Wild life and conservation, ecology of India.
(c) Physiography, Climate, Vegetation and soil regions, Broad
Physical divisions of India, human resources, problems of
population, unemployment, poverty, drought famines and
desertification in India.
(d) Energy problems and conventional and non-conventional
sources of energy.
4. Agriculture and Economic Development of India - Food and
Commercial crops, agriculture base industries, Major irrigation and
rivers valley projects, Growth and location of industries. Industrial
raw materials, Mineral based Industries, Small Scale & Cottage
Industries, Export items, various economic plans, programmes and
institutions for development. Cooperative movement, small
enterprises and financial institutions.
5. History and Culture - Main currents in World History, Art and
Culture, Landmarks in the political and cultural history of India,
Major monuments, and Literary works. Renaissance, struggle ofr
freedom & national integration.
PAPER II. GENERAL KNOWLEDGE OF RAJASTHAN,
RAJASTHANI SOCIETY, ART & CULTURE
1. Geography and Natural Resources -
(a) Broad Physical Features : Topography, Climate, Vegetation
and Soil Regions, Rivers, Mountains, Lakes, Natural
divisions, Geographical regions.
(b) Natural Resources : Mines and Minerals, Forest, Land and
Water, Wild life and Conservation, Environmental Ecology.
(c) Livestock and Fisheries, Breed, Population, Regional
Distribution, Cattle Fairs.
(d) Human Resources, Population problem, Unemployment,
Poverty, Drought and Famines.
(e) Energy Problems and Conventional and Non-conventional
sources of energy.
2. Agriculture & Industry - Food and Commercial Crops, Agriculture
based Industries. Major and Minor Irrigation & River Valley
Projects. Projects for the development of the desert and waste land,
Indira Gandhi Canal Project. Growth and location of Industries,
Industrial raw materials. Mineral Based Industries, Large, Small
and Cottage Industries, Rajasthani Handicrafts.
3. Economic Development and Planning - Various Economic Plans.
Programmes and Institutions for development, Co-operative
movement, Small Enterprises and Financial Institutions, Various
indicators of Economic development.
4. History, Polity, Art & Culture - History & Culture of Rajasthan
with special reference to :
1. The mediaeval background.
2. Socio-economic life and organizations.
3. Freedom Movement and Political awakening.
4. Political Integration.
5. Music, dance & theatre.
6. Religious beliefs, cults, saints, poets and warrior saints 'Lok
Devta', 'Lok Deviyan'.
7. Handicrafts.
8. Fairs and Festivals, Customs, Dresses & Ornaments. With
special reference to fold and tribal aspects thereof.
5. Literature - Rajasthani Language, Dialects and their regions,
History of language and literature, famous writers, poets and their
works with special reference to flok-lore.
PAPER-IV. GENERAL ENGLISH
PART-A
1. Comprehension of a given passage
2. Translation (from Hindi to English)
PART- B
3. Modern English Usage :
(a) Tense usage including sequence of tenses and concord.
(b) Phrasal verbs and idioms.
(c) Determiners.
(d) Passive voice.
(e) Coordination and Subordination.
(f) Direct and Indirect speech.
(g) Modals expressing various concepts :
Obligation, Request, Permission, Prohibition, Intention, Condition,
Probability, Possibility, Purpose, Reason, Comparison, Contrast.
PART- C
4. Report Writing
(Writing a report on the basis of given information)
5. Business and Official letters
6. Essay (not exceeding 300 words)
